**Rebuilds acting weird?** Quixlet's incremental static builder caches page fragments in Redis, so a stale cache usually means the invalidation hook never fired. Kick off a manual partial rebuild with `quix rebuild --changed-only` and watch the logs. Before that works, add the webhook signing secret to `.env.oncall` on the line below.

vault entry, kafog-yahop: COURIER_KEY8=0faa53ae

Handover note for weekly eng sync — Quillmark autocomplete index

From Darya to Helsin: the autocomplete index on the Quillmark search tier is still slow, p95 around 900ms. Root cause is the prefix trie rebuilding on every deploy instead of loading the warm snapshot. I added snapshot loading behind a flag; it's validated in staging but not enabled in prod. Remaining work: enable the flag, then retire the rebuild path. The snapshot archive is encrypted, and the recovery passphrase is below.

vault phrase of kafog-kahif = holdor-rusir-praox

# Basement Archive Room — Night Access

The archive room under Pellworth House holds old contracts and the tape backups. Night shift: take stairwell C, not the lift (it's switched off after midnight). Lights are on a timer by the door — slap the button as you go in. Sign the logbook, even at 3am, yes really. The keypad by the door takes the code below.

staff pass of fahap-tajeg = bdg-FT-6